Central limit theorems for the derivatives of self-intersection local time for $d$-dimensional Brownian motion

Abstract

Let {Bt,t0}\{B_t,t\geq0\} be a d-dimensional Brownian motion. We prove that the approximation of the higher derivative of renormalized self-intersection local time 010s(pd,ϵ(k)(BsBr)E[pd,ϵ(k)(BsBr)])drds, \int_{0}^{1}\int_{0}^{s}\left(p^{(|k|)}_{d,\epsilon}(B_{s}-B_{r})-E[p^{(|k|)}_{d,\epsilon}(B_{s}-B_{r})]\right)drds, where the multiindex k=(k1,,kd)k=(k_{1},\cdots,k_{d}), pd,ϵ(k)(x1,x2,,xd):=x1k1x2k2 p_{d,\epsilon}^{(|k|)}(x_1,x_2,\cdots,x_d):=\partial^{k_1}_{x_1}\partial^{k_2}_{x_2} xdkdpd,ϵ(x1,x2,,xd)\cdots\partial^{k_d}_{x_d}p_{d,\epsilon}(x_1,x_2,\cdots,x_d) and pd,ϵ(x)=1(2πϵ)d/2ex22ϵ,xRdp_{d,\epsilon}(x)=\frac{1}{(2\pi\epsilon)^{d/2}}e^{-\frac{|x|^{2}}{2\epsilon}}, x\in\mathbb{R}^d, satisfies the central limit theorems when renormalized by (log1ϵ)1(\log\frac{1}{\epsilon})^{-1} in the case d=2d=2, k=1|k|=1 and by ϵd+k32\epsilon^{\frac{d+|k|-3}{2}} in the case d3d\geq 3, k1|k|\geq 1, which gives a complete answer to the conjecture of Markowsky [In S\'{e}minaire de Probabiliti\'{e}s \uppercase\expandafter{\romannumeral10\romannumeral50\romannumeral4} (2012) 141-148 Springer]. We as well prove that its m-th Wiener chaotic component satisfies the central limit theorems when renormalized by a multiplicative factor in different cases.
